Lincoln -- The No. 9 women's rifle team will attempt to earn an invitation to nationals when the Huskers compete at a collegiate sectional match hosted by Xavier University on Saturday.
The scores from sectional matches held across the nation are compiled by the NCAA, which then invites a maximum of eight teams in both the air rifle and smallbore to compete at the national championships in March.
Despite recording the lowest team totals in the air rifle this season, the Huskers are coming off their second-highest team score, tallying a combined score of 6,102 points at the Roger Withrow Invitational on Jan. 30.
Nebraska's previous high of 6,108 came at the first meet of the season. Other than shooting a 4,584 in the smallbore in their first match, Nebraska's 4,568 at the Roger Withrow is their highest score this season.
On Sunday the Huskers will head to Ohio State.
